■ SYSWAY Command Lists
• No commands will be accepted and no responses will be returned when a memory error (RAM error)
has occurred or during initialization (until the process value is recognized after power is turned ON).
• When a write operation is performed while there is a memory error (EEPROM error), data will not be
written and the command will end with “normal completion.” Read operations will be executed
normally.
Note 1: The number of EEPROM (non-volatile memory) write operations is limited. Therefore, use RAM
write mode when frequently overwriting data.
Note 2: The process value read range is the same as the input’s display range.
Note 3: Status (last 4 bytes)Note 4. Status (first 2 bytes)
• Overflow: Set 1 when the heater current value is greater than 55.0 A.
• Display hold: Set 1 when the control output ON time is less than 100 ms. The previous heater current
value is held.
